Historical Events on May 11

  • 1846: U.S President asks Congress for a Declaration of War against Mexico. His request is approved on May 13th and starts the Mexican-American War.
  • 1857: Indian rebels seize the city of Delhi from British forces during the Indian Rebellion of 1857.
  • 1858: Minnesota becomes the United States’ 32nd
  • 1862: The CSS Virginia is scuttled in the James River just north of Norfolk, Virginia.
  • 1910: Glacier National Park in the state of Montana is established by an act of the United States Congress.
  • 1927: On this day, the Academy of Motion Picture Arts and Sciences is officially established.
  • 1942: “Go Down, Moses”, a collection of short storied by William Faulkner is published.
  • 1943: In an attempt to drive out Imperial Japanese Forces in the Aleutian Islands, American forces invade Attu Island during World War 2.
  • 1944: A major offensive on the Gustav Line is made by the Allies against Axis forces.
  • 1945: Over 340 crew members are killed when the USS Bunker Hill is hit by 2 dive-bombing kamikaze planes off the coast of Okinawa. The damaged vessel was still able to return to the United States under its own power, however.
  • 1995: More than a hundred and seventy countries decide to extend the Nuclear Nonproliferation Treaty. And they do so indefinitely and without any conditions placed on the deal.
  • 1997: Garry Kasparov is defeated in a rematch between him and the chess-playing supercomputer known as Deep Blue.
  • 2011: A 5.1 magnitude earthquake hits Lorca, Spain.
  • 2016: An ISIL bombing in the city of Baghdad ends up killing more than 100 people.

Famous Birthdays on May 11

  • Belarusian-American composer, Irving Berlin is born in 1888.
  • British painter Paul Nash is born in 1889.
  • English actress Margaret Rutherford is born in 1892.
  • American painter Gladys Rockmore Davis is born in 1901.
  • Spanish painter and illustrator, Salvador Dali is born in 1904.
  • English-American actress Natasha Richardson is born in 1963.
  • American actor Jeffrey Donovan is born in 1968.
  • American actress and singer, Sabrina Carpenter is born in 1999.
